Key Factors Influencing Dryer Vent Cleaning Costs

Vent System Complexity & Accessibility

Before: Homeowners often assume all dryer vents are short, straight, and easy to access. This leads to underestimating the effort involved.
After: The reality is far more intricate. The length of the vent, the number of turns or elbows, and the materials used (e.g., rigid metal vs. flexible foil) all play a role. A longer vent, or one with multiple bends snaking through walls or attics, takes more time, specialized tools, and expertise to clean effectively. Similarly, vents that terminate on a roof or are embedded deep within building structures (common in some older Cherry Hill homes) require additional effort and safety precautions, directly impacting labor costs. Degree of Blockage & Debris

Before: A clogged vent was just "a lot of lint," often only discovered when the dryer stopped working.
After: The extent of the blockage can vary significantly. Some vents have a minor accumulation of lint, while others might be completely choked, sometimes containing rodent nests, debris from pests, or even foreign objects. The National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) reports that dryers are responsible for approximately 13,820 fires each year, with failure to clean being a leading factor. Removing heavy, compacted blockages or unusual obstructions demands more time, specialized extraction equipment, and often multiple passes, increasing the service cost. Additional Services & Repairs

Before: The dryer was cleaned, and that was that. Any underlying issues were left unaddressed.
After: During a professional cleaning, our technicians may identify underlying problems such as disconnected ducts, crushed sections, damaged vent caps, or even improper installation. These issues not only hinder airflow but can also pose safety risks. Addressing these repairs or replacements, like installing a new, more efficient vent cap or rerouting a damaged section, will be an additional cost but is crucial for long-term safety and efficiency. Type of Property & Frequency of Cleaning

Before: "Set it and forget it" was the mentality for dryer maintenance, regardless of usage.
After: Residential properties in Cherry Hill typically require cleaning every 1-2 years, depending on usage habits and dryer type. However, for homes with high dryer usage (large families, laundry-intensive hobbies) or certain pet owners, more frequent cleaning might be advisable. Commercial properties, such as laundromats or apartment complexes, often have different pricing structures due to the volume of work and specialized requirements. Also, if a vent has never been professionally cleaned, the initial service will likely involve a more extensive effort compared to routine maintenance, as decades of lint might need removal. Frequently Asked Questions About Dryer Vent Cleaning

  • Q1: How often should I have my dryer vent cleaned?
    A1: We recommend professional cleaning at least once a year for most Cherry Hill households. Homes with heavy dryer usage, pets, or large families might benefit from semi-annual cleaning.
  • Q2: What are the signs of a clogged dryer vent?
    A2: Common signs include clothes taking longer to dry, clothes feeling unusually hot after a cycle, a burning smell, excessive lint on clothes, and the dryer turning off prematurely due to overheating.
  • Q3: Can I clean my dryer vent myself?
    A3: While basic lint trap cleaning is encouraged, thorough dryer vent cleaning requires specialized tools and expertise to ensure complete removal of lint and debris, especially in longer or complex vent systems. DIY attempts often miss significant blockages and can even cause damage.
  • Q4: Does dryer vent cleaning improve energy efficiency?
    A4: Absolutely. A clean dryer vent allows your dryer to operate efficiently, reducing drying times and consequently lowering your energy consumption. This can lead to noticeable savings on your utility bills.
  • Q5: How long does a typical dryer vent cleaning take?
    A5: Most standard residential dryer vent cleanings take 1 to 2 hours, though more complex systems or severe blockages may require additional time.
  • Q6: Is dryer vent cleaning covered by homeowners insurance?
    A6: While the cleaning itself is not typically covered, preventing a dryer fire through professional cleaning could save you from needing to file a claim due to fire damage, which would be covered.
